Output 39be7b68900ad7250100022beec8814f6c9791d95addebebef245fc287fed8bc:1

value
2551656
script pubkey
OP_0 OP_PUSHBYTES_20 099ddc59661562ffe09e3035966223a19b17e1e4
address
ltc1qpxwacktxz430lcy7xq6evc3r5xd30c0ymy58j8
transaction
39be7b68900ad7250100022beec8814f6c9791d95addebebef245fc287fed8bc
spent
true